What type of eater are you?
Classic Overeater
Some people overeat because of giant portion sizes
(know anyone who eats everything on their plate
in order to get their money’s worth?). Some
people eat out of boredom. Some eat for social
reasons, whether grazing at a cocktail party or
sampling the baked goods at a school function.
The bottom line is, overeating has become quite
an ordinary thing to do. Overeating simply causes
your body to store fat.
Starvation Victim
The most common mistake people make is equating
eating with getting fat. If overeating causes
your body to store fat, then shouldn’t undereating
prevent it from getting fat? Absolutely not! Eating
too little, just like eating too much, also causes
your body to store fat. If you eat less food than
your body needs to survive, it will think that
you are slowly starving to death and will try
at all costs to hold onto the fat for future use
so that it won’t starve.
The old adage “You are what you eat”
is only partially true. The Panzer Plan will show
you that as well, “You are how you eat.”
Caveman Approach
People often eat a small to moderate amount of
food during the day and then blow it with a huge
dinner. This is the Caveman approach. Doing this
is like begging your body to store fat. Your body
is starving and then gets a huge meal. Your body
can't possibly use all of what you just consumed
so naturally a large number of calories get stored
as fat. Your daily caloric intake may even be
correct, but getting so many calories at one meal
completely sabotages you.

The 5 Facts on Fat
1) Getting fat is a natural survival mechanism that
your body needed thousand of years ago but no longer
needs.
2) Eating too little will cause your body to store
fat.
3) What and when you eat is just as important as
how much you eat.
4) Controlling insulin response to food is necessary
to be lean.
5) You must be physically active to be lean.
